Set in a picturesque Mediterranean town, a captivating housekeeper named Marietta finds herself at the center of a complex situation involving desire and deception. Several men are vying for her attention, but Marietta is drawn to Enrico, whom she hopes to marry. To achieve her goal, she cleverly manipulates the affections and ambitions of her pursuers, turning their own schemes against them in a battle of wits and charm.
